数据库文件备份频率:多久备份一次才安全?

数据库文件多久备份一次

时间:2025-05-01 20:20


数据库文件备份频率:为何定期备份至关重要 在当今数字化时代,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是零售等行业,数据都扮演着举足轻重的角色

    数据库作为数据存储的核心组件,其安全性和可靠性直接关系到企业的运营效率和业务连续性

    然而,数据丢失或损坏的风险始终存在,自然灾害、硬件故障、人为错误或恶意攻击都可能导致数据灾难

    因此,定期备份数据库文件已成为企业风险管理不可或缺的一环

    本文将深入探讨数据库文件备份的重要性,分析备份频率的考量因素,并提出合理的备份策略建议

     一、数据库备份的重要性 1. 数据恢复的基础 数据库备份是数据恢复的前提

    当数据库遭遇损坏、删除或丢失时,备份文件是唯一的恢复来源

    通过备份,企业可以快速将数据库恢复到最近的一次备份状态,从而最大限度地减少数据丢失和业务中断

     2. 应对灾难性事件 自然灾害(如地震、洪水)和硬件故障(如硬盘损坏、服务器宕机)等灾难性事件可能导致数据库无法访问

    定期备份可以确保企业在遭遇此类事件后,仍能从备份中恢复数据,保障业务的连续性

     3. 法规遵从性 许多行业和地区都有关于数据保护和隐私的法规要求

    定期备份数据库文件不仅有助于保护数据,还能确保企业在面对法规审查时能够提供完整的数据记录,满足合规要求

     4. 防止人为错误 人为错误(如误删除、误修改)是导致数据丢失的常见原因之一

    定期备份可以为企业提供一种撤销机制,即使发生人为错误,也能通过恢复备份来撤销错误操作

     二、备份频率的考量因素 确定数据库文件的备份频率是一个复杂的过程,需要考虑多个因素

    以下是一些关键的考量因素: 1. 数据变化频率 数据变化频率是影响备份频率的首要因素

    对于高频变化的数据(如交易系统、在线购物平台),需要更频繁的备份以确保数据丢失的风险最小化

    相反,对于低频变化的数据(如历史档案、静态信息库),备份频率可以相对较低

     2. 业务连续性需求 不同业务对数据连续性的需求不同

    对于关键业务(如银行交易系统、医疗信息系统),任何数据丢失都可能导致严重后果,因此需要更频繁的备份

    而对于非关键业务(如企业宣传网站、内部管理系统),备份频率可以适当降低

     3. 备份资源限制 备份过程需要消耗存储空间、计算资源和网络带宽等资源

    在制定备份策略时,企业需要权衡备份频率与资源限制之间的关系

    对于资源有限的企业,可能需要通过优化备份策略(如压缩、增量/差异备份)来降低资源消耗

     4. 法规遵从性要求 某些行业和地区的法规可能对数据备份的频率有明确要求

    企业在制定备份策略时,需要确保符合相关法规要求,以避免合规风险

     5. 恢复时间目标(RTO)和恢复点目标(RPO) 恢复时间目标(Recovery Time Objective, RTO)是指从灾难发生到业务完全恢复所需的时间

    恢复点目标(Recovery Point Objective, RPO)是指业务可以容忍的数据丢失量

    企业需要根据自身的RTO和RPO需求来制定备份频率

    例如,对于RTO和RPO要求较高的业务,需要更频繁的备份以确保快速恢复和最小化数据丢失

     三、合理的备份策略建议 1. 全量备份与增量/差异备份结合 全量备份是指备份整个数据库的所有数据

    虽然全量备份恢复简单,但会消耗大量存储空间和备份时间

    增量备份是指仅备份自上次备份以来发生变化的数据

    差异备份则是指备份自上次全量备份以来发生变化的所有数据

    结合使用全量备份和增量/差异备份,可以在确保数据完整性的同时,降低存储空间和备份时间的消耗

     2. 自动化备份 手动备份不仅耗时费力,还容易出错

    因此,企业应采用自动化备份工具来定期执行备份任务

    自动化备份工具可以根据预设的备份策略自动执行全量备份、增量备份或差异备份,并将备份文件存储在指定的位置

    通过自动化备份,企业可以确保备份过程的可靠性和一致性

     3. 异地备份与云备份 为了防止本地灾难导致数据丢失,企业应实施异地备份策略

    异地备份是指在远离主数据中心的地方存储备份文件,以确保在本地发生灾难时仍能恢复数据

    此外,随着云计算技术的发展,云备份已成为一种越来越受欢迎的选择

    云备份可以将备份文件存储在云端服务器上,实现数据的远程存储和快速恢复

    结合使用异地备份和云备份,可以进一步提高数据的可靠性和安全性

     4. 定期测试备份 备份文件的有效性需要通过测试来验证

    企业应定期测试备份文件,确保它们可以在需要时成功恢复数据库

    测试备份的过程包括恢复备份文件到测试环境中,并验证数据的完整性和业务的连续性

    通过定期测试备份,企业可以及时发现并解决备份过程中可能存在的问题

     5. 制定备份策略文档 制定详细的备份策略文档是确保备份过程规范化和标准化的关键

    备份策略文档应包括备份的频率、类型、存储位置、恢复流程等信息

    通过制定备份策略文档,企业可以确保所有相关人员都了解备份过程的要求和流程,从而提高备份的可靠性和一致性

     四、结论 定期备份数据库文件是企业风险管理不可或缺的一环

    通过合理的备份策略,企业可以确保数据的完整性、安全性和可用性,降低数据丢失和业务中断的风险

    在制定备份策略时,企业需要综合考虑数据变化频率、业务连续性需求、备份资源限制、法规遵从性要求以及RTO和RPO等因素

    此外,结合使用全量备份与增量/差异备份、自动化备份、异地备份与云备份以及定期测试备份等措施,可以进一步提高备份的可靠性和效率

    最终,通过制定详细的备份策略文档,企业可以确保备份过程的规范化和标准化,为企业的数字化转型和业务发展提供坚实的数据保障